Verse 7.33.12

परलोकमहाव्याधौ प्रयतन्ते चिकित्सनम् ।
शमसत्सङ्गबोधाख्यैरमृतैः पुरुषोत्तमाः ॥ १२ ॥

paralokamahāvyādhau prayatante cikitsanam |
śamasatsaṅgabodhākhyairamṛtaiḥ puruṣottamāḥ || 12 ||

The best sort of men are trying to heal their spiritual maladies, and avert their future fate, by means of the ambrosial medicines of dispassionateness, keeping good company and improvement of their understanding.
